Why was Anne Hutchinson banished from Massachusetts?

History
2 answers:
galben [10]3 years ago
8 0

Answer:

B. She questioned the teaching of the Puritan leaders.

Explanation:

At that time, Anne Hutchinson openly challenged the teaching that Puritan Leaders had on receiving salvation.

The puritans believe in sanctification (God's salvation can be earned  Doing Good works in the name of god). Hutcherson on the other hand believed in receiving salvation through justification ( All humans can do is to accept Christ into their life. Eventually, God is the one who decide whether Humans get the salvation or not. Nothing human can really do to earn it.)

Because of this, the Puritan Leaders accused Anne Hutchinson of Heresy banished her out from Massachusetts.
